James L. Kerr III papers, 1914-1989 1917-1967.

This collection contains photocopies of documents, articles, clippings, reference materials, blueprints, listings, notes, maps, ephemera, photographs, 8mm films, micro films, video tapes, and video disks created and/or collected by James L. Kerr, III during his lifetime. Series I. Entente has three subseries : (a) Great Britain subseries consists of RFC/RAF squadron histories, combat casualties, communiqués, unit locations in France, summaries of air intelligence reports, combat in the air reports, daily reports, war diaries, squadron record books, and daily reports of operations, (b) France subseries contains compte rendu reports or daily reports from French units, and (c) USAAS subseries contains pilot listings and American air intelligence bulletins and summaries. Series II. Central powers has two subseries : (a) German subseries consists of the Nachrichtenblatt der Luftstreitkräfte of the various armies of the Kommandeur der Fliegertruppen (KOFL), the Marine Luftfahrt-Abteilung, Marine-Flieger-Abteilung, and German Extracts, and (b) k.u.k. Austro-Hungarian subseries includes the Nachrichtenblatt der k.u.k. Luftfahrtruppen, pilots, aircraft manufacturers and Austrian-Hungarian units listings. Series III. Publications has three subseries : (a) Entente subseries contains articles and clippings regarding aircraft manufacturers and their various models, unit histories, and pilot's biographies and their achievements. Some of the articles were authored or co-authored by James L. Kerr. Of particular interest are the articles on Italian units, battles, and personnel, namely the Caporetto articles Part I through III or Silvio Scaroni by Kerr, (b) Central subseries includes articles and clippings pertaining to the German and k.u.k. Austro-Hungarian as well as the Ottoman Air Forces and their aircraft, biographies, and units, and (c) general publications subseries covers general topics of World War I aviation history that do not necessarily fall into the above mentioned categories. The researcher will find catalogs and reference sources and a chronology of World War I here. Series IV. Audiovisual media has four subseries : (a) Moving images subseries includes various video tapes and 8mm film depicting topics like Battle of Britain, The Dawn Patrol, or Hell's Angels among others. Of interest are items 12 and 13 covering the Over the Front seminar held by Kerr, (b) Still images subseries contains microfilm covering the records of the American Expeditionary Forces, combats in the air reports and war diaries of RFC/RAF as well as photographs and transparencies of aircraft, units, and personnel of all the main countries engaged in World War I, (c) Audio subseries contains two audio tapes with titles Zeppelins-, and various symphonies of Ludwig van Beethoven, and (d) Video disk subseries are from the Smithsonian Air & Space Museum containing indices of aircraft manufacturers and other aircraft types, biographical information, as well as information about aviation collections overseas.

31.10 linear ft.

James Lee Kerr III was born on May 27, 1946 in Corpus Christi, Texas to a family with a long tradition of service to the United States Navy and roots in Texas dating back to 1822. Kerr's father's deployments with the Navy allowed young James views of many countries throughout the world including the Philippine Islands and Norway.
